how to specify line breaks for a transcript in a vtt file?

Foliovision › Forums › FV Player › How to … › how to specify line breaks for a transcript in a vtt file?

  • Curt F. 7 years, 2 months ago

    I’ve been able to get the basic functionality of the interactive transcript working, but is there a way to indicate line breaks, as with lines of dialogue? As it is, the transcript displays lines of dialogue all together in a single paragraph… though it seems to make a paragraph break about every 30-35 seconds. Here’s an excerpt of my .vtt file:

    Hello Curt,

    I was looking at the specs of VTT here: https://www.w3.org/TR/webvtt1/#introduction-multiple-lines

    So each cue in the VTT file should be displayed as a separate paragraph and linebreaks in each cue should be displayed too.

    In FV Player Pro this works a bit differently as you noted. The idea is that if you have a lot of short individual entries in VTT they form a bigger paragraph. It also checks for the full sentences. That keeps the text condensed and it’s generally better if you just take some subtitle file and use it as a transcript.

    If we would really show each cue in VTT as a separate paragraph the transcript would appear much longer and it would be harder to read. But I see that for dialogues it would be better.

    Hello Martin, thanks for the explanation – I now have a better sense of what’s going on. If I understand correctly, FV Player Pro is automating the line/paragraph breaks; for my purposes, that’s unfortunate, since my content consists sometimes of paragraph-style narration, and sometimes short lines of dialogue. It makes sense to have a lot of short cues for subtitles, but transcripts can be different – I often have a cue of only about every 15 seconds for narration, but much more often for dialogue, and I need to be able to allow for the difference.

    Perhaps at some point there could be a toggle for whether FV Player checks for sentences etc., or whether it just goes strictly by the cues? Otherwise I’m not sure I’ll be able to use it after all. :(
